Chris Burniske Warns of a Shakedown in the Crypto Market: What It Means for Investors
Chris Burniske has taken to X (previously Twitter) to share his interests about the potential for a market rectification. He proposes that while crypto stays in a bull cycle, there could be a critical shakeout around the initiation of President-elect Donald Trump. This occasion could set off a "sell-on-news" response, prompting transient market disturbance.

Chris Burniske Warns of a Shakedown in the Crypto Market: Key Indicators to Watch
Investors should keep an eye on several key indicators that may signal an upcoming market correction:
Excessive Market Exuberance: When investors become overly optimistic, it often precedes a downturn.
Leverage Levels: High levels of margin trading can amplify losses when the market corrects.
Institutional Movements: Large sales by institutional investors can trigger broader market declines.

Revised Market Cap Projections and Their Implications
Already, Burniske projected that the absolute cryptographic money market cap could reach $10 trillion during this cycle. In any case, he has now amended this gauge, proposing that while the market areas of strength for stays, $10 trillion achievement may not be arrived at in this cycle. This change highlights the requirement for reasonable assumptions even with market publicity.
Chris Burniske Warns of a Shakedown in the Crypto Market: How to Navigate Market Frenzy
To navigate the anticipated market correction, investors should consider the following strategies:
Diversification: Holding a mix of assets can reduce risk.
Profit-Taking: Selling a portion of holdings during market peaks can secure gains.
Risk Management: Setting stop-loss orders can prevent significant losses.
